summaryrefslogtreecommitdiff
path: root/guix/scripts
diff options
context:
space:
mode:
authorLudovic Courtès <ludo@gnu.org>2019-11-18 22:59:21 +0100
committerLudovic Courtès <ludo@gnu.org>2019-11-19 10:51:53 +0100
commit1bdb63e73b73a6b581b65c4018aae587aebfcab4 (patch)
tree78a4f68d646ba5adc5d945a8e753859cf184242d /guix/scripts
parent6fbd8fde2fad113dbfc90c8b1b55f7ead919a90a (diff)
deploy: Handle "--version".
* guix/scripts/deploy.scm (%options): Add "--version".
Diffstat (limited to 'guix/scripts')
-rw-r--r--guix/scripts/deploy.scm4
1 files changed, 4 insertions, 0 deletions
diff --git a/guix/scripts/deploy.scm b/guix/scripts/deploy.scm
index f311587ec3..27b7e4fd1c 100644
--- a/guix/scripts/deploy.scm
+++ b/guix/scripts/deploy.scm
@@ -62,6 +62,10 @@ Perform the deployment specified by FILE.\n"))
(lambda args
(show-help)
(exit 0)))
+ (option '(#\V "version") #f #f
+ (lambda args
+ (show-version-and-exit "guix deploy")))
+
(option '(#\s "system") #t #f
(lambda (opt name arg result)
(alist-cons 'system arg